We performed femtosecond time-resolved coherent anti-Stokes Raman scattering (fs-CARS) measurements on liquid toluene and PVK film. For both samples, we selectively excited the CH stretching vibrational modes and observed the expected quantum beat signals. The frequency of the well-defined beats is in good agreement with the energy difference between the two simultaneously excited modes, which demonstrates that a coherent coupling between the vibrational modes of the C H chemical bonds exists at the different positions of the molecules. The dephasing times of the excited modes are obtained simultaneously. 展开更多

The models of stress corrosion, pressure solution and flee-face dissolution/precipitation were introduced. Taking a hypothetical nuclear waste repository in an unsaturated dual-porosity rock mass as the calculation objective, four cases were designed 1) the fracture aperture is a function of stress corrosion, pressure solution and free-face dissolution/precipitation; 2) the fracture aperture changes with stress corrosion and pressure solution; 3) the fracture aperture changes with pressure solution and free-face dissolution/precipitation; 4) the fracture aperture is only a function of pressure solution, and the matrix porosity is also a function of stress in these four cases. Then, the corresponding two-dimensional FEM analyses for the coupled thermo-hydro-mechanical processes were carried out. The results show that the effects of stress corrosion are more prominent than those of pressure solution and free-face dissolution/precipitation, and the fracture aperture and relevant permeability caused by the stress corrosion arc only about 1/5 and 1/1000 of the corresponding values created by the pressure solution and free-face dissolution/precipitation, respectively Under the action of temperature field from released heat, the negative pore and fracture pressures in the computation domain rise continuously, and are inversely proportional to the sealing of fracture aperture. The vector fields of flow velocity of fracture water in the cases with and without considering stress corrosion are obviously different. The differences between the magnitudes and distributions of stresses within the rock mass are very small in all cases. 展开更多

The model of pressure solution for granular aggregate was introduced into the FEM code for analysis of thermo-hydro- mechanical (T-H-M) coupling in porous medium. Aiming at a hypothetical nuclear waste repository in an unsaturated quartz rock mass, two computation conditions were designed: 1) the porosity and the permeability of rock mass are fimctions of pressure solution; 2) the porosity and the permeability are constants. Then the corresponding numerical simulations for a disposal period of 4 a were carried out, and the states of temperatures, porosities and permeabilities, pore pressures, flow velocities and stresses in the rock mass were investigated. The results show that at the end of the calculation in Case 1, pressure solution makes the porosities and the permeabilities decrease to 10%-45% and 0.05%-1.4% of their initial values, respectively. Under the action of the release heat of nuclear waste, the negative pore pressures both in Case 1 and Case 2 are 1.2-1.4 and 1.01-l.06 times of the initial values, respectively. So, the former represents an obvious effect of pressure solution. The magnitudes and distributions of stresses within the rock mass in the two calculation cases are the same. 展开更多

A coupled numerical calculation method combining smooth particle hydrodynamics(SPH)and the finite element method(FEM)was implemented to investigate the seismic response of horizontal storage tanks.Anumericalmodel of a horizontal storage tank featuring a free liquid surface under seismic action was constructed using the SPH–FEM coupling method.The stored liquid was discretized using SPH particles,while the tank and supports were discretized using the FEM.The interaction between the stored liquid and the tank was simulated by using the meshless particle contact method.Then,the numerical simulation results were compared and analyzed against seismic simulation shaking table test data to validate the method.Subsequently,a series of numerical models,considering different liquid storage volumes and seismic effects,were constructed to obtain time history data of base shear and top center displacement,which revealed the seismic performance of horizontal storage tanks.Numerical simulation results and experimental data showed good agreement,with an error rate of less than 18.85%.And this conformity signifies the rationality of the SPH-FEM coupling method.The base shear and top center displacement values obtained by the coupled SPH-FEM method were only 53.3% to 69.1% of those calculated by the equivalent mass method employed in the current code.As the stored liquid volume increased,the seismic response of the horizontal storage tank exhibited a gradual upward trend,with the seismic response increasing from 73% to 388% for every 35% increase in stored liquid volume.The maximum von Mises stress of the tank and the supports remained below the steel yield strength during the earthquake.The coupled SPH-FEM method holds certain advantages in studying the seismic problems of tanks with complex structural forms,particularly due to the representation of the flow field distribution during earthquakes by involving reservoir fluid participation. 展开更多

In this study, the magnetohydrodynamic (MHD) flow through a circular pipe under the influence of a transverse mag- netic field when the outside medium is also electrically conducting is solved numerically by using FEM-BEM coupling approach. The coupled partial differential equations defined for the interior medium are transformed into homogenous modified Helmholtz equations. For the exterior medium on an infinite region, the Laplace equation is considered for the exterior magnetic field. Unknowns in the equations are also related with the corresponding Dirichlet and Neumann type coupled boundary conditions. Unknown values of the magnetic field on the boundary and for the exterior region are obtained by using BEM, and the unknown velocity and magnetic field inside the pipe are obtained by using SUPG type stabilized FEM. Computations are carried for very high values of magnetic Reynolds numbers Rm1, Reynolds number Re and magnetic pressure Rh of the fluid. The results show that using stabilized method enables us to get stable and accurate numerical approximations consistent with the physical configuration of the problem over rough mesh which also results a cheap computational cost. 展开更多

The compositional coupling between aboveground vegetation and soil seed bank is critical for community stability and successional trajectories,but such relationships are highly sensitive to environmental changes.Although nitrogen(N)deposition has been reported to decouple the associations between aboveground vegetation and the soil seed bank in grasslands,it remains unclear whether and how grassland management practices,such as mowing,mediate N deposition effects.We evaluated the impacts of N input and mowing on the diversity and composition of the aboveground vegetation and soil seed bank,as well as their compositional coupling in a decadal grassland experiment.N addition increased the compositional dissimilarity between the soil seed bank and aboveground vegetation by increasing abundance gradient,but only in unmown plots.N addition did not affect the compositional dissimilarity between aboveground vegetation and the soil seed bank in mown plots.Mowing increased the graminoid abundance in the aboveground vegetation,but increased the forb abundance in the soil seed bank,and thus increased the compositional dissimilarity between aboveground vegetation and the soil seed bank by promoting balanced variation in abundance.Our results reveal the importance of context dependence in the consequences of N inputs on the compositional coupling between aboveground vegetation and the soil seed bank in grasslands.The land-use context should be fully considered when evaluating the impacts of global change drivers on grassland community dynamics and succession. 展开更多

The dynamic evolution of fracture permeability presents a critical scientific challenge in rock masses.Understanding the mechanisms of rock mass permeability evolution is vital for engineering project design and operations.By integrating the discrete element method(DEM)with the finite element method(FEM),a numerical simulation framework for shear seepage in rough fractured shale has been developed to investigate the dynamic mechanisms of permeability evolution under varying confining pressures and during the shearing process.Numerical simulations were conducted on rough fractured samples under effective confining pressures ranging from 5 MPa to 20 MPa to monitor the aperture and permeability evolution of the fracture.The results of the numerical simulation are consistent with the experimental observations,indicating that both the shearing process and confining pressure significantly influence permeability.Moreover,the magnitude of the confining pressure is a crucial factor influencing the trend in permeability changes.Under a confining pressure of 5 MPa,fracture permeability initially increases significantly but decreases post-shearing.In contrast,a continuous decrease in fracture permeability is observed when the confining pressure exceeds 10 MPa.The results of the shear numerical simulation indicate that the confining pressure restricts fracture dilation during shearing,promotes the generation of rock debris,and decreases both the permeability and transmissivity of the fracture.The wear results obtained from numerical simulations are consistent with the experimental patterns and correlate with the joint roughness coefficient(JRC).This study proposed an effective numerical simulation method to reveal the evolution mechanism of fracture flow capacity,taking into account the wear of the fracture surface in shear simulations and the initial stress state of the rock in seepage simulations.This research explains the permeability evolution mechanism of fractured shale from a microscopic perspective,and the proposed numerical simulation method for shear seepage provides a powerful means to uncover the dynamic evolution mechanisms governing fracture permeability. 展开更多

Platinum diselenide(PtSe2)exhibits a distinctive thickness-modulated semiconductor-to-semimetal transition,which makes it suitable for diverse applications in nanoelectronics and optoelectronics.This study systematically investigates the spatiotemporal dynamics of photoexcited carrier relaxation in PtSe2.Through temperature-dependent ultrafast spectroscopy,two distinct low-frequency acoustic phonons(AP)were identified in multilayer PtSe2.Transient absorption microscopy(TAM)measurements reveal thickness-dependent relaxation dynamics and distinct carrier diffusion behavior in multilayer PtSe2.These findings indicate superior carrier transport properties,with a measured mobility of(394.1±38.5)cm2/(V·s)for multilayers.Temperature-dependent ultrafast dynamics,acquired using a custom-built cryogenic pump-probe system,reveal two coherent AP modes with central frequencies ofω1=1.27 THz andω2=0.17 THz,respectively.The higher frequencyω1mode corresponds to the shear mode with a nominal electron-phonon coupling constantλω1=2.22.This study,based on low-temperature ultrafast spectroscopy,elucidates the low-frequency acoustic phonon mode and strong electron-phonon coupling effect in the semimetal PtSe2.These findings lay the foundation for a deeper understanding of the semimetallic properties of PtSe2and for the design of ultrafast photonic devices. 展开更多

Blast effects and energy transfer in near-ground explosions differ significantly from underground scenarios,particularly in terms of ground shock propagation and energy coupling mechanisms across various geological conditions.This study employs centrifuge modeling to simulate near-ground explosions in sandy soil,including surface explosions and airbursts.The focus was on blast-induced cratering,ground shock effects,and energy coupling in sandy foundations.Scaling laws for crater dimensions and ground shock parameters were established and validated based on experimental results.The"modeling of models"series showed good consistency in crater measurements,leading to an empirical formula for estimating crater radius in dry sand.For surface explosions,soil acceleration responses showed single peaks in the central zone(horizontal standoff distance<0.6 m/(kg)1/3)and dual peaks in the near-surface zone(0.79-1.2 m/(kg)1/3)due to combined effects of direct and airburst-induced ground shock.Empirical methods were developed to predict peak acceleration distributions in sandy foundations.Utilizing crater measurements and ground shock propagation laws,a computational approach for evaluating energy transmission in soil foundations was proposed.The study also developed prediction curves for ground shock energy coupling coefficients with scaled blast depth/height,providing a unified model for both underground and near-ground explosions in sandy foundations.The research findings can enhance the methodologies for simulating blast effects and offer a scientific basis for optimizing weapon effectiveness and protective engineering design. 展开更多

To accelerate the development and utilization of fusion energy,the China Fusion Engineering Test Reactor(CFETR)has been proposed as a bridge between the International Thermonuclear Experimental Reactor and demonstration fusion reactors.The primary objective of the CFETR is to achieve fusion energy transformation and tritium self-sufficiency,which is realized through the function of the blanket.In this study,a neutronicshermal-hydraulics/mechanics coupling method is developed and applied to a helium-cooled ceramic breeder(HCCB)blanket,which is one of the two blanket candidates for the CFETR.A three-dimensional full-scale model is utilized in the coupling analysis to obtain the distributions of the neutronic,thermal-hydraulic,and mechanical parameters.A structural assessment of the CFETR HCCB blanket is then conducted considering steady-state conditions and two transient scenarios.The results demonstrate that following optimization of the blanket structure,the maximum temperatures of the different components remain below the safety limit of the corresponding materials.The structural assessment indicates that the blanket maintains its structural integrity under steady-state conditions.However,immediately after an in-box loss-of-coolant accident,structural failure owing to stress concentration may occur.Additionally,in the early stage of a loss-of-flow accident,the stress at the joint point between the cooling plate and cap exceeds the allowable stress of the material,potentially leading to structural failure within 17 s if no protective response is implemented.These findings provide comprehensive insights into the performance and safety of the CFETR HCCB blanket design. 展开更多
